[PATCH RFC net-next v3 4/8] vsock: make vsock bind reusable

From: Bobby Eshleman
Date: Tue May 30 2023 - 20:36:03 EST


This commit makes the bind table management functions in vsock usable
for different bind tables. For use by datagrams in a future patch.
